There are several liters of 55% alcohol. After adding one liter of 80% alcohol, the concentration becomes 60%. To get 75% alcohol, 80% alcohol is needed. How many liters of 80% alcohol are needed to get 75% alcohol?


Let x rise
Alcohol 55% X
Plus 1
Then 55% x + 1 * 80% = 60% (x + 1)
0.55x+0.8=0.6x+0.6
0.05x=0.2
x=4
Let y be added
That's 4 + y liters
Alcohol is 4 * 55% + 80% y = 75% (y + 4)
2.2+0.8y=0.75y+3
0.05y=0.8
y=16
A: add 16 liters
